Задание 2. По данным ситуациям определить необходимое программное обеспечение. 1. Аскар купил новую клавиатуру. Но произошла проблема, компьютер не опознал устройство. Как решить проблему?
2. В большой организации часто информацию сотрудники переносят с съемных носителей, не проверяя на вирус. Какие программы потребуются для устранения этих проблем?
3. Сауле решила обучающую игру по биологии. Какую программу вы посоветуете? К какому ПО относится?
4. Учителю требуется создать тест для проверки знаний учащихся по химии. К какому ПО относится тест?
PascalABC.NET 3.7:
###RS.AdjacentGroup.SelectMany(x → x.Len >= 3 ? x.Len + x[0] : x.Str).PrПояснение:
RS - ReadString: Возвращает значение типа string, введенное с клавиатуры.
AdjacentGroup: Группирует одинаковые подряд идущие элементы, получая последовательность массивов.
SelectMany: Проецирует каждый элемент последовательности в новую последовательность и объединяет результирующие последовательности в одну последовательность.
.Len - .Length: Длина массива.
.Str - .JoinToString: Преобразует последовательность символов в строку, не используя разделитель (при последовательность другого типа данных в качестве разделителя используется пробел).
.Pr - .Print: Выводит последовательность символов на экран, не используя разделитель (при последовательность другого типа данных в качестве разделителя используется пробел).
Пример работы:
Для начала составим уравнения перемещения:
S0 = (V0+V1)*t0
S1 = V1*(t0+4)
По условию: S0 = S1
Значит:
(V0+V1)*t0 = V1*(t0+4) = V1*t0+4V1
(V0+V1)*t0 - V1*t0 = V0*t0 = 4V1
t0 = 4*V1÷V0
Так как движутся в одном напралвении: V0 > 0
Отсюда видно, что зависимость обратно пропорциональная. И так как ограничения на скорость V0 в условии не задано, то можно подобрать скольугодно большую скорость, такую, что время t0 будет < 2.
Проверим в табличном процессоре.
Создадим документ со следующей структурой (рисунок 1).
Выставим V1 согласно условиям. V0 изначально пусть будет = 1. (рисунок 2)
Проведём поиск решений, оптимизируя время и изменяя скорость V0, со следующими ограничениями (рисунок 3)
В результате табличный процессор сообщает, что время может быть сколь угодно маленьким. (рисунок 4).